Output 63634655dbad79db4c56fbc31cb6012e19371d2e1ce55d9166edcb66d155075b:1

value
140653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4456036154ebfd34ed0bd79b44d559b7d53e58eb OP_EQUAL
address
37vLutbZkuAAPw1eczfRWbNvzibWjgLcEy
transaction
63634655dbad79db4c56fbc31cb6012e19371d2e1ce55d9166edcb66d155075b
confirmations
316346
spent
true